Sorry, but once you get into headphones you might never end up with a permanent pair. Or you may end up with several, and still be interested in more!

I have recently been through several including AKG 701, Sennheiser HD485, HD515, HD555, Equation Audio RP15 and RP21, Goldring DR150, JVC HA-RX700, Ultimate Ears Super.Fi 4, Soundmagic PL30 and PL12, Audio Technica ATH EC7, and a few more. Also went through several different headphone amps. It is a lot of fun trying new stuff, and it is kind of shocking when you discover that the most expensive or highly regarded gear is not your favorite. For my particular taste (and big head) I liked the JVC, Senn HD485, Equation RP21, and Soundmagic PL30 the best out of all of those.... and they are mostly cheaper models.

Don't be afraid to buy used, and definately be prepared to resell whatever you try if it doesn't fit your needs.
